Common Types of Plumbing Products
1. Pipes
Pipes form the backbone of every plumbing system. They are available in various materials, including PVC, CPVC, UPVC, HDPE, and metal, depending on the intended application.
Common uses include:
- Drinking water supply
- Hot water distribution
- Irrigation systems
- Industrial fluid transportation
- Drainage and sewage systems
2. Pipe Fittings
Fittings connect, redirect, or terminate pipe sections.
Properly matched fittings help create leak-resistant and durable plumbing networks.
3. Valves
Valves regulate water flow and pressure throughout a plumbing system. Ball valves, gate valves, check valves, and butterfly valves are commonly used for controlling and isolating water supply lines.
4. Faucets and Taps
Available in numerous designs and finishes, faucets combine functionality with aesthetics. Modern options often feature water-saving technology and easy maintenance.
5. Bathroom Fixtures
Products such as showers, wash basins, flush systems, and sanitary accessories contribute to user comfort while supporting water conservation.
6. Drainage Components
Floor drains, traps, waste pipes, and drainage fittings ensure proper wastewater management and help prevent unpleasant odors and blockages.
7. Water Storage and Distribution Accessories
Connectors, clamps, hoses, and pressure regulators support efficient water delivery while protecting the integrity of the plumbing system.

Maintenance Tips for Long-Lasting Plumbing Systems
Regular maintenance extends the service life of plumbing products and helps avoid unexpected repairs.
Recommended practices include:
- Inspect pipes and fittings periodically.
- Check for leaks around joints and fixtures.
- Clean drains to prevent blockages.
- Replace worn washers and seals promptly.
- Monitor water pressure levels.
- Flush water heaters according to manufacturer recommendations.
- Schedule professional inspections when necessary.
Preventive maintenance protects both the plumbing system and the surrounding property.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Many plumbing issues arise from preventable errors, including:
- Purchasing low-quality materials solely based on price
- Mixing incompatible components
- Ignoring manufacturer guidelines
- Delaying repairs after minor leaks appear
- Using incorrect pipe sizes
- Skipping pressure testing after installation
- Choosing products without considering long-term durability
Avoiding these mistakes can significantly improve system reliability and reduce ownership costs.
